Output 762daee690ef30a1600fe93a57541ca6cf966c38a08e75f638a780003a2d6862:156

value
17398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9173fa8feaa2af605d5e6e4a55fc6a6847327b5d OP_EQUAL
address
3Ex6qhpT5fWpUMp9TCdbTYm79TGYUkXKTo
transaction
762daee690ef30a1600fe93a57541ca6cf966c38a08e75f638a780003a2d6862
spent
true